Yard Debris
Year Round, York County residents have the opportunity to schedule a special yard debris collection for items such as limbs, branches, and clear bags of natural yard waste by calling 757-890-3780 or through our Customer Service Request Portal.
Curbside Yard Debris Collections
- Acceptable material size for curbside pickup is 8” diameter and 10’ feet in length.
- All residents who subscribe to the York County curbside solid waste program may schedule two yard debris collections per month (approximately 24 cubic yards) at a rate of $25 per collection. Each additional load collected within 30 days after the first collection will be an additional $100 per load. Non subscribers to the solid waste program may schedule up to two collections within a 30 day period at a rate of $75 per collection.
- Loose yard debris, grass, leaves and straw must be placed in clear bags.
- Stumps, dirt or debris with dirt, construction debris, and other materials cannot be collected.
- Scheduled materials must be at the front roadside by 7:00 a.m. Monday of your collection week.
- The VPPSA Compost Facility will accept residential and commercial yard debris deliveries of material up to 24” diameter and 10’ length.
- All landscape contractors and residents who do not subscribe to the York County curbside solid waste program who bring yard waste to the VPPSA Compost Facility will be charged a tipping fee of $48 per ton (prorated).
- Contractors are required to call one week in advance to the Waste Management Office at 757-890-3780 so staff can come out and see the yard debris you want to dispose of while they it is still on your ground (757-890-3780). If approved, the disposal fees will be waived. In addition, you must deliver the material in person (i.e. no employees, neighbors, or family members not living in your household.) If you do not meet the above criteria, a disposal fee will be required.
